Bridging Simulators with Conditional Optimal Transport

arXiv — stat.MLWednesday, October 29, 2025 at 4:00:00 AM
A new field-level emulator has been introduced that connects two simulators using unpaired datasets, which is a significant advancement in simulation technology. This method utilizes a flow-based approach to accurately learn how to transport data from one simulator to another while preserving its structure. By employing Conditional Optimal Transport Flow Matching, the transformation minimizes distortion, making it a promising tool for researchers and developers in various fields. This innovation not only enhances the accuracy of simulations but also opens up new possibilities for data analysis and modeling.
